Brown Sugar Worth ₹8 Lakh Seized In Bhadrak, One Arrested

Bhadrak: The Excise Department in Bhadrak has seized 80 grams of brown sugar worth approximately ₹8 lakh and arrested one person in connection with illegal drug trafficking. The seizure was made during routine patrolling by the mobile unit of the Excise Department on Thursday.

According to sources, Excise officials were conducting regular patrols when they noticed a bike rider behaving suspiciously. Acting on the suspicion, the mobile unit intercepted the biker and carried out a thorough check. During the inspection, officials recovered 80 grams of brown sugar from his possession.

Preliminary investigation revealed that the accused had allegedly brought the contraband for the purpose of selling it in the area. The seized brown sugar is estimated to be worth around ₹8 lakh in the illegal market.

Following the recovery, the Excise Police arrested the accused and seized the motorcycle used for transporting the narcotics. Further investigation is underway to ascertain the source of the drugs and to identify other individuals involved in the racket.

Excise officials stated that intensified patrolling and surveillance will continue as part of the ongoing crackdown against drug trafficking in the district.
